what is md5 technology - An Overview
what is md5 technology - An Overview
Blog Article
It is really similar to Placing the blocks by way of a substantial-velocity blender, with Just about every spherical additional puréeing the combination into one thing fully new.
Cryptographic methods evolve as new attack practices and vulnerabilities arise. Consequently, it really is critical to update stability actions regularly and stick to the latest tips from trusted cryptographic gurus.
Deprecation by Sector Benchmarks: Because of its safety flaws, MD5 is abandoned by the majority of threat-mindful organizations. It really is not appropriate for digital signatures or password storage.
Afterwards inside the ten years, numerous cryptographers commenced ironing out the basic particulars of cryptographic features. Michael Rabin put ahead a design determined by the DES block cipher.
Assistance us boost. Share your ideas to boost the report. Add your know-how and come up with a change in the GeeksforGeeks portal.
A hash collision takes place when two distinctive inputs produce the exact same hash worth, or output. The safety and encryption of a hash algorithm depend upon generating one of a kind hash values, and collisions represent stability vulnerabilities which can be exploited.
Some MD5 implementations which include md5sum could possibly be restricted to octets, or they might not assist streaming for messages of an in the beginning undetermined length.
All of it depends on your certain desires and instances. So, consider a while to be familiar with Every of those possibilities prior to choosing which just one to undertake for your hashing wants.
Diffie-Hellman algorithm:The Diffie-Hellman algorithm is being used to determine a shared mystery that may be employed for secret communications when exchanging information in excess of a community community utilizing the elliptic curve to generate points and acquire The trick key utilizing the parameters. For the sake of simplicity and useful implementation with the algorithm, we
S. and/or other nations around the world. See Logos for acceptable markings. Some other trademarks contained herein would be the property in their respective house owners.
The size from the hash worth (128 bits) is small enough to contemplate a birthday assault. MD5CRK was a dispersed undertaking commenced in March 2004 to reveal that MD5 is practically insecure by finding a collision using a birthday attack.
Printed as RFC 1321 all over thirty many years ago, the MD5 concept-digest algorithm continues read more to be greatly employed these days. Using the MD5 algorithm, a 128-little bit much more compact output is usually developed from the message input of variable duration. This is a style of cryptographic hash that's created to make electronic signatures, compressing substantial documents into smaller types in a very secure method and afterwards encrypting them with a private ( or top secret) important to get matched which has a public crucial. MD5 can even be utilized to detect file corruption or inadvertent adjustments in large collections of information being a command-line implementation applying typical Laptop languages which include Java, Perl, or C.
MD5 is taken into account insecure on account of its vulnerability to varied kinds of attacks. The most vital worry is its susceptibility to collision attacks, where two distinctive inputs develop the exact same hash output.
When it provides stronger stability assures, it isn’t as broadly adopted as its predecessors since it’s more difficult to carry out and current methods require updates to introduce it.